What is TPS in Minecraft?

Last updated
Ever wondered what TPS means in the world of Minecraft? You’re not alone! TPS stands for Ticks Per Second and is a crucial aspect of the game’s performance. Let’s dive into what this means for your gameplay.
When we talk about TPS in Minecraft, we’re looking at how many times the game updates in one second. Understanding this can really change your Minecraft experience.
Short Answer: What Does TPS Mean in Minecraft?
TPS in Minecraft refers to the number of ticks, or updates, that happen in the game each second. Normally, Minecraft aims for a steady 20 TPS. This means the game updates 20 times every second.
Why does this matter? Well, a high TPS means the game is running smoothly. Everything from moving around to the day-night cycle updates without a hitch. But if the TPS drops, you might start noticing delays, like your actions taking longer to happen. It’s like the game is slowing down.
